Understanding Outsource Call Center Services

What Are Outsource Call Center Services?

Outsource call center services refer to the practice of delegating customer service and communication functions to an external third-party company. The primary objective is to enhance the efficiency of business operations by leveraging the specialized skills and technology provided by the outsourcing partner. Instead of managing in-house staff, which can involve substantial costs and complexity, companies choose to outsource to benefit from established infrastructures, knowledgeable personnel, and advanced communication technologies.

These services encompass a range of functions, including inbound customer support, outbound marketing calls, technical support, and handling customer inquiries via email and chat. Organizations can select from various service models, including dedicated teams, shared resources, and hybrid models, aligning their choice with specific business needs and customer expectations. Key Features of Effective Outsource Call Center Services

The effectiveness of outsourced call center services is defined by several features that contribute to operational success. These include:

  • 24/7 Availability: A round-the-clock service ensures customer needs are met at any time, en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.
  • Multilingual Support: Having agents available in multiple languages can significantly expand a company’s customer base, catering to international markets.
  • Advanced Technology: The use of sophisticated software for customer relationship management (CRM) and analysis tools enables higher call quality and better customer insights.
  • Customizable Solutions: Services should be tailored to meet the unique needs of each business, ensuring that the outsourced team aligns with the client’s brand values and strategy.
  • Analytics and Reporting: Comprehensive reporting on key performance indicators (KPIs) helps businesses monitor performance and make data-driven decisions.

Benefits of Outsource Call Center Services

Cost Savings and Pricing Structures

One of the most compelling reasons businesses choose to outsource call center services is the significant reduction in operational costs. Maintaining an in-house call center entails substantial expenses related to hiring, training, and retaining staff, along with overhead costs associated with technology and infrastructure. By outsourcing, companies can convert fixed costs into variable costs, paying only for the services they need when they need them.

Moreover, many outsourcing partners offer flexible pricing models, such as pay-per-call, subscription-based pricing, or tiered packages that allow businesses to select options that suit their budget and requirements. This flexibility makes it easier for companies to control costs in fluctuating markets, adapting their level of service quickly without the constraints of traditional employment.

Challenges in Outsource Call Center Services

Communication Barriers and Solutions

One of the most significant challenges faced in outsource call center services is communication barriers, which can stem from language differences, cultural misunderstandings, or geographical distance. Such issues can result in miscommunication, leading to customer dissatisfaction and negatively impacting business relationships.

To mitigate these barriers, businesses should consider partners with proficiency in their target language(s) and an understanding of the cultural nuances relevant to their customer base. Regular training sessions emphasizing communication skills and cultural awareness can enhance agent performance. Utilizing technology, such as chatbots or automated customer relationships management software, can also streamline communication and reduce misunderstandings.

Quality Control and Monitoring Processes

Maintaining a high standard of service quality is paramount in any outsourced operation. Without stringent quality control measures, there is a risk of inconsistency in service delivery. Companies must establish clear guidelines for service level agreements (SLAs) that outline expected performance metrics and standards.

Continuous monitoring should be implemented, using call recordings and performance analytics to evaluate agent performance regularly. Additionally, conducting customer satisfaction surveys can provide insights into service quality from the customer’s perspective. By maintaining these oversight methods, businesses can intervene proactively to resolve issues before they escalate.

Measuring Success in Outsource Call Center Services

Key Performance Indicators to Track

Measuring the success of outsource call center services hinges on the identification and tracking of key performance indicators (KPIs). Common metrics include average handle time, first call resolution rate, customer satisfaction scores, and service level compliance.

By continuously evaluating these KPIs, businesses can derive insights into operational efficiency and the overall effectiveness of the outsourced team. Monitoring trends and patterns over time can aid in proactive decision-making, ensuring that service levels meet and exceed customer expectations.

Customer Feedback and Satisfaction Metrics

Customer feedback is invaluable in assessing the quality of service provided by outsourced call centers. Implementing customer satisfaction surveys and Net Promoter Scores (NPS) can provide quantitative insights into customer perspectives and help gauge overall satisfaction with the service.

Analyzing customer feedback allows businesses to identify areas of strength and potential improvement. Utilizing qualitative feedback alongside quantitative metrics creates a comprehensive understanding of customer needs and expectations, enabling continual enhancement of service delivery.
